61 unregistered childcare centres in Sarawak

KUCHING: Sarawak Social Welfare Department has found 61 unregistered childcare centres or nurseries (taska) since the beginning of the year. According to the department’s statistics, a total of 47 centres had been issued with warning notices while 13 ceased operations as of June 13. Full vaccination expected for educations, assistants

KUCHING: Educators and their assistants at kindergartens and nurseries are expected to be fully vaccinated statewide, said Datuk Seri Fatimah Abdullah. The Welfare, Community Wellbeing, Women, Family and Childhood Development Minister added as of July 1, a total of 6,021 or 84 percent of educators and their assistants from the private sector have been vaccinated.
